2002 Volkswagen Phaeton vs. 2011 Nissan 370Z

To start off, 2011 Nissan 370Z is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ton would be higher. At 4,921 cc (10 cylinders), 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Nissan 370Z (332 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 24 more horse power than 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ton. (308 HP @ 3750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Nissan 370Z should accelerate faster than 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ton weights approximately 911 kg more than 2011 Nissan 370Z.

Because 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2011 Nissan 370Z.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ton (750 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 384 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Nissan 370Z. (366 Nm @ 5200 RPM). This means 2002 Volkswagen Phaeton will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Nissan 370Z.
